Arkansas stayed at No. 1 and Clemson moved to No. 2 in the latest CBI Composite Poll.

The Razorbacks had a 4-0 week, with a win over Little Rock and a three-game SEC sweep of No. 7 LSU. Arkansas is No. 1 in all five national polls.

The Tigers won an ACC series at Miami (Fla.). Clemson was second in all five polls.

Texas A&M went 4-0 and bumped up one spot to third. The Aggies defeated HCU before sweeping a three-game SEC set from Auburn. TAMU was third in all five polls.

Tennessee had a 3-1 week and moved up one place to fourth. The Vols beat Tennessee Tech before winning an SEC series from Georgia. UT was fourth in three polls and fifth in the other two.

Oregon State lost two games at USC and dropped from second to fifth. The Beavers were fourth in one poll, fifth in three polls and ninth in the other.

NC State returned to the poll, while preseason No. 1 Wake Forest dropped out of the poll.

There are nine teams from the SEC in this week’s CBI Composite Poll. There are seven from the ACC and single entries from the American, Big West, CUSA and Pac-12.
